The Meaning and the Necessity of Theatre Students' Conferences

The results of the questionnaire seek to explore the meaning and necessity of Theatre students' conferences. The aim is to investigate whether (international) conferences are treated as a learning tool and as an opportunity for improvement.


The results will be used in the Lithuanian Music and Theatre  Academy, Department of Theatre and Film, Arts Management,Theatre Management first year MA student Viktorija Ivanova's term paper writing.
